Referring to fig. 1-3, the utility model provides an injection mold with accurate die-cut feed inlet of sloping-edge terrace die, including bed die 1 and mould 3, the top fixed mounting of bed die 1 has four guide slots 2 that are the rectangle and arrange, the bottom fixed mounting of bed die 1 has four guide arms 4 that mutually support with corresponding guide slot 2, four recess 5 that are the rectangle and arrange are seted up at the top of bed die 1, seted up circular slot 7 on the bottom inner wall of recess 5, be equipped with plectane 6 in the recess 5, seted up slide opening 14 on plectane 6, slidable mounting has cylinder 8 in the slide opening 14, cylinder 8 runs through slide opening 14, slidable mounting has slide 9 in circular slot 7, the bottom of cylinder 8 and the top fixed connection of slide 9, fixed mounting has spring 11 on the bottom plate inner wall of circular slot 7, the top of spring 11 and the bottom fixed connection of slide 9;
in this embodiment, as shown in fig. 1 to 3, two threaded holes are formed in the circular plate 6, bolts 12 are respectively disposed in the two threaded holes, two thread grooves 13 are formed in the inner wall of the bottom of the groove 5, and the bottom ends of the two bolts 12 respectively extend to the corresponding thread grooves 13 and are in threaded connection with the inner walls of the corresponding thread grooves 13.
The inner wall of the sliding hole 14 is fixedly provided with a wear-resistant gasket, and the cylinder 8 is in sliding connection with the inner wall of the wear-resistant gasket.
Four arc-shaped grooves which are rectangular are formed in the bottom of the upper die 3, semicircular balls are fixedly mounted on the top ends of the four cylinders 8, and the four arc-shaped grooves are matched with the corresponding semicircular balls.
The inner wall of the bottom of the circular groove 7 is fixedly provided with a limiting trapezoidal block, and the spring 11 is sleeved on the limiting trapezoidal block in a sliding manner.
The bottom of the sliding plate 9 is fixedly provided with a round tube 10, and the round tube 10 is slidably sleeved on the spring 11.

The working principle is as follows: when last mould 3 and lower mould 1 compound die, four guide arms 4 of going up mould 3 bottom will inject respectively in four guide slots 2 on the lower mould 1, when lower mould 1 and last mould 3 will contact soon, the semicircle ball on four cylinders 8 will contact with four arc walls of last mould 3 bottom, along with last mould 3 and the continuous being close to of lower mould 1, cylinder 8 will extrude spring 11 through slide 9, thereby produced impact force when spring 11 can cushion last mould 3 and the compound die of lower mould 1, when spring 11 compressed, spring 11 can be avoided taking place to squint by pipe 10 and trapezoidal stopper, when spring 11 takes place fatigue impaired, can be through taking off two bolts 12, make 6 take off from recess 5 in the plectane, thereby be convenient for change spring 11.
